Gerard Smythe’s documentary When a City Falls is a collective examination of the Canterbury earthquakes, physical and emotional damage.
Smythe and his team filmed over 100 hours of footage capturing the emotion & resilience of the Christchurch community. This stunning documentary gives all New Zealanders, and those further aboard (who saw hours of devastating news coverage), the opportunity to experience the emotion of individuals and the human spirit of a community coming together in a time of high emotion. When A City Falls serves as an important historical record of one of this country’s most devastating events.
